Evaluation of Solidification Cracking Susceptibility of VDM Alloy 780 Under Different Solution Annealing Conditions and Comparison with Alloy 718

The weld solidification cracking susceptibility of VDM Alloy 780, a new superalloy designed to possess superior thermal stability up to 750 ℃ in comparison to Alloy 718, was evaluated under different pre-weld solution annealing conditions that produce different base material grain sizes, and compared to that of Alloy 718, using the Varestraint weldability test. Solidification cracking in VDM Alloy 780 is unaffected by pre-weld solution annealing, and the cracks are associated with the NbC and γ/Laves eutectic constituents. In actual fabrication, where restraint is low to moderate, VDM Alloy 780 is expected to possess comparable susceptibility to solidification cracking to Alloy 718.
